DESCRIPTION = "Bootlogo support" SECTION = "base" LICENSE = "CLOSED" require conf/license/license-close.inc PRIORITY = "required" PROVIDES += "vuplus-bootlogo" RPROVIDES_${PN} += "vuplus-bootlogo" IMAGES_VERSION = "1" BINARY_VERSION = "7" PV = "${BINARY_VERSION}.${IMAGES_VERSION}" INC_PR = "r9" SRC_URI = "file://bootlogo.mvi file://backdrop.mvi file://bootlogo_wait.mvi" S = "${WORKDIR}/" PACKAGES = "${PN}" INHIBIT_PACKAGE_STRIP = "1" do_install() { install -d ${D}/boot ${D}${datadir}/vuplus-bootlogo install -d ${D}/usr/share for file in *.mvi; do install -m 0644 $file ${D}${datadir}/vuplus-bootlogo ln -s vuplus-bootlogo/$file ${D}${datadir} ln -sf ${datadir}/vuplus-bootlogo/$file ${D}/boot/$file; done } PACKAGE_ARCH := "${MACHINE_ARCH}" FILES_${PN} = "/boot ${datadir} ${sysconfdir}" inherit update-rc.d INITSCRIPT_PARAMS = "start 70 S . stop 89 0 ." INITSCRIPT_NAME = "vuplus-bootlogo" SRC_URI += "file://${INITSCRIPT_NAME}.sysvinit" do_install_append() { if [ -f ${WORKDIR}/${INITSCRIPT_NAME}.sysvinit ]; then install -d ${D}${INIT_D_DIR} install -m 0755 ${WORKDIR}/${INITSCRIPT_NAME}.sysvinit ${D}${INIT_D_DIR}/${INITSCRIPT_NAME} fi }